Transaction e311a4451b91dafa21531c6d08e11ac29543d507987ad322274d4388d7e76c75
1 Input
1 Output
-
e311a4451b91dafa21531c6d08e11ac29543d507987ad322274d4388d7e76c75:0
- value
- 59023
- script pubkey
- OP_0 OP_PUSHBYTES_20 1cb4c7926954d1d2f59dea40f1a200e0cd4527aa
- address
- bc1qrj6v0ynf2nga9avaafq0rgsqurx52fa2jv497n